Trojan.Comet.A is a dangerous Trojan that allows attackers to obtain remote control and access over a targeted computer. Trojan.Comet.A helps attackers to use your PC as a part of Denial of Service (DoS) attacks. Once installed, Trojan.Comet.A makes changes to a computer system and modifies the registry. Trojan.Comet.A will disable the Task Manager and contact its remote host at infinitypro.hopto.org using port 5555 on the system. Usually Trojan.Comet.A will contact its developers at this domain in order to report a new infection to its developers, to get configurations and other data from the developers, to download and execute other malware threats to the PC system that include arbitrary files and updates.
